Students Project Report:

Mr. Karthick Nag:       Automatic Water dispenser using arduino

The aim of this project to address this issue by developing a system that accurately measures and dispenses specific amount of water based on user input.  By incorporating technology and automation, we can achieve precise water management and reduce wastage.

Mr. Charan:        Human following robot using arduino

The main objective of this project is to make a robot that can help humans with various tasks.  In this project we present a prototype of a human following robot that uses Arduino Uno and different sensors for detection and the object. The robot must be capable of accurately follow a person. And it should be capable of taking various degrees of turn.

Mr.Praveen Kumar:     Obstacle avoidance robot with Bluetooth and voice control

This project proposes obstacle avoidance with Bluetooth and Voice control.  By use of android mobile to control a robot by way of Bluetooth and voice commands.

Mr. Dhanush Kumar:  Gesture control robot using arduino

This project will control the Gesture and follow the human instructions using sensor and gesture control.

Mr.Janardhan:    Gas leakage detection system using arduino

A Gas leakage detector system plays a vital role in ensuring the timely detection and prevention of hazardous gas leaks.  Gas leakage is a significance safety concern in various industries, commercial and Gas leakage settings.  The requirements of a gas detection system is to monitor the surroundings continuously.  The buzzer starts beeping whenever fire is detected.

Objective of the Seminar:

  1. Proficiency in Verbal Communication: Most of the young graduates lack the confidence and fluency while interacting verbally. Coming either from rural or sub-urban background, many students hold good academic record and industrial skills but lack behind while expressing themselves. This small yet major drawback often hinders the achievements of students while campus placements. Speaking about a researched topic in seminars and workshops before a gathered audience boosts the confidence of the students preparing them precisely for interviews and group discussions.
  2. Acquirement of Knowledge in a Particular Field: Seminars and workshops provide a chance to interact with experts from the specific field. Discussing about the relevant topics of the particular subject, students tend to learn about the latest information and new skills related to the concerned subject. As a result of genuine interest shown by the students to know and learn about the subject, they research about the particular topic with the help of expert guidance and land in their conclusion after a careful investigation, experiment, and simulation.
  3. Growth in Networking: In seminars and workshops the students and faculties from different educational institution join to take part. Meeting new people can help the students in getting guidance and solutions related to common problems. Making new friends can not only encourage new ways of thinking and learning but might open up new opportunities as well. Even after the completion of seminar or workshop programs, these chains of networking can help the students in escalation of their professional life.
  4. Encouragement and Motivation: Talking and learning about a new topic will encourage the students to explore new areas relevant to the topic. Students will feel motivated to research and learn new things. With proper guidance from teachers and experts, students feel motivated to publish their own research journals, contributing significantly to the education sector.
  5. A Different Environment than Classroom: In a learning environment different and unique from classrooms, students learn more effectively and efficiently. Far from the textbooks and academic syllabuses, students research and learn on their own which boost their confidence, performance, and productivity.
